Hi

I want to join my Hikvision Cams to my Home-Automation System RTI.
On my RTI System i have only a Generic MJPEG Video Viewer.


Can u tell me the correct URL for the MJPEG-Stream.

I already try this:


http://user:pass@192.168.10.24/Streaming/channels/102/httppreview
http://user:pass@192.168.10.24/Streaming/channels/102/preview

http://192.168.10.24/Streaming/channels/2/httppreview
http://192.168.10.24/Streaming/channels/102/preview?auth=x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x==

I see the Stream for 1Second, after that i see this failure:

<ResponseStatus version="1.0"><requestURL>/Streaming/channels/102/preview</requestURL><statusCode>4</statusCode><statusString>Invalid Operation</statusString></ResponseStatus>

First you have to set the sub stream to MJPEG while this is the only one available for MJPEG request (2xx2 IP cam series).
Then use the following syntax:

http://user:pass@ip_address/Streaming/channels/102/httppreview

This works for me (I've tested using VLC player).
